The concept of a "Transgender Tipping Point" emerged in the mid-2010s, marked by high-profile media representation. Actors like Laverne Cox ( Orange is the New Black ), Elliot Page ( The Umbrella Academy ), and MJ Rodriguez ( Pose ) have delivered nuanced, authentic performances that move away from historical tropes of trans people as punchlines or villains. At its core, "transgender" is an umbrella term for people whose gender identity differs from the sex they were assigned at birth. This includes trans women, trans men, and non-binary people (those who identify outside the traditional man/woman binary).
Today, this intersection stands at a critical cultural and political juncture. While queer visibility has reached historic highs in media and leadership, the transgender community simultaneously faces unprecedented legal, social, and institutional pushback globally.
